I have the Darkside EGR delete. Its a nice piece of kit. What you will find though is you will be left with the pipe that comes off the cooler round to the front. I had mine removed when I had the DPF gutted and the bloke who did it said it was a pig to do. Ended up cutting it in 2, half out the front, half out the back.
Once the EGR is removed you can remove the cooler aswell. I didn't do this as when I spoke to Ryan at Darkside he wasn't sure if it was the same set up as the 140. I assume it is but didn't want to take the risk until I knew for sure.
Whoever does your remap for you will have to map out the egr too as it is physically disconnected. If I scan mine with VCDS, it shows a fault for the EGR, but this isn't flagged on the dash as an engine management light.
